Hematochezia: The term for bright red blood per rectum is hematochezia. There are multiple possibilities. It may be from hemorrhoids (internal or external). If you are a middle aged or older male, it may be bleeding from a polyp. Or a diverticular bleed. Or another source. There That it is a few drops might be slightly reassuring. It should be evaluated by a clinician. Please see your PCP as soon as possible.
